  • Error Message in Query Filter on attribute of 0MATERIAL filters charac.

    Hi All,
    i have a query with few variables , i used navigational attributes of 0material......
    I am getting the below Warning Message...  Ineed to supress the below Error Message....
    Please let me know the solution...
    Error Message: Filter on attribute of 0MATERIAL filters charac. values without master data
    Diagnosis
    Currently, it cannot be guaranteed that SIDs and master data exists for all characteristic attributes for the DataStore object to be read.
    There is a restriction on a navigation attribute of the listed characteristic in the query. This filters all characteristic values of the master-data bearing characteristic for which there is not yet master data out of the result.
    For performance reasons, this filtering is unavoidable.
    System Response
    Procedure
    In case of doubt, find other restirctions directly on the characteristic values of the characteristics contained in the DataStore object.
    Procedure for System Administration
      Notification Number DBMAN 345 
    Thanks All

    Dear all SAP Gurus,
    we've solved this problem and this is the solution:
    The warning is triggered by the method CL_RSDRV_ODS_QUERY-PROCESS_SFC_WITH_ATR when the BExFlag of the InfoProvider is not set. Using DSOs for direct update there is no change to change the BExFlag. As a result queries based on a DSO for direct update always throw the above mentioned warning when filter-characteristics are attributes.

  • Doubt in attribute view on joining the table .

    Hello Team
                        Can some please help me in clearing the following doubts on joining tables .
    i) Can we perform a self join in attribute view in HANA . like for ex :- joining a table to itself .
    ii)Can we create an analytic view without creating an attribute view i.e creating an analytic view directly on tables .
    iii)When aggregation happens in calculation view exactly what happens internally .
    Please suggest me with the solution of these doubts .
    Regards

    Hi Prag,
    As Rashmi has answered your question, i would like to add up to it few more important points.
    1. Do not perform self join as it will return uncertain results. It is better to avoid self join.
    You can create a copy of the same table and perform join which will be consistent.
    2. In an analytic view, you will be adding table to data foundation, select the output fields.In the logical join node by default your data foundation will be present (this will contain the fields that you selected for output), you need not add any attribute view to this logical join node, leave it to default. In the semantics node select the attributes and measures. Perform validation and then activate. Your analytic view without attribute view is ready. You can check the data preview.
    3. In a calculation view, the records gets grouped by all the attributes and then the measures are calculated based on this grouping by using the mentioned aggregation (sum/max/min).
    Eg.
    Customer ID 0Calmonth Amount (aggregation = max)
    1001               01.2014     100         
    1001               01.2014     400
    1002               01.2014     200
    Output:
    Customer ID 0Calmonth Amount (aggregation = max)
    1001               01.2014     400
    1002               01.2014     200
    Hope this clarifies your doubts.

  • How to get the distinct values in Attribute View?

    Hi,
    While doing the data preview of attribute view its showing duplicate records.
    Can i restrict all these duplicate in attribute view and get only distinct values?
    Thanks in advance.

    Hi Deepak,
    Please check the Key Attribute combination in the Source System and Create Attribute view with the same combination.
    so that you won't get any duplicate values.
    If you are taking fields randomly Pls ensure that you are taking at least one primary key combination  use the same combination while creating Attribute View.
    As u know that the purpose of Attribute view is to store the Master Data Objects like BI/BW which stores Non duplicate values.
